ZyWALL IDP 10 Quick Start Guide 4. Enable/disable the stealth function on either or both the LAN and WAN ports. The MGMT port has no stealth function. Stealth enabled on a port means that the ZyWALL IDP drops all incoming packets destined for the ZyWALL IDP received on that port with no response to the sender. When you enable Stealth on a port, you cannot perform management via that port. When Stealth is enabled on a port, the ZyWALL IDP doesn’t respond to ICMP requests such as Ping (

ZyWALL IDP 10 Quick Start Guide Inline means the ZyWALL IDP will both identify suspicious or malicious packets and perform the action dictated by the rule for that type of intrusion (block, log, drop, send an alarm). Monitor means the ZyWALL IDP will function as a traditional IDS (Intrusion Detection System) by identifying suspicious or malicious packets and then sending alerts (only). Bypass means the ZyWALL IDP allows all LAN and WAN traffic to pass through it without inspe
